Competition Day for the 2025 Rip Curl Longboard Nationals started with gloomy weather and a 4ish-foot windswell slamming shapelessly into the low-tide sandbars. All reports indicated that the first few heats didn\u2019t come easy.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cIt was pretty horrible,\u201d says Rusty Goyer. \u201cThat\u2019s just Cox Bay and we\u2019re used to it.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">But the conditions improved as the tide came in and while it was anything but perfect, there were plenty on waves to go around.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cConditions were consistent all day so that always makes it fun,\u201d says Mathea Olin, who ended up taking first place for the women. \u201cI\u2019m very grateful that the sun came out and that so many people are down here enjoying this beautiful day.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Yes indeed, the sun showed up around noon and shone brightly all the way through finals. That\u2019s good because those of us who wanted to lazily enjoy the livestream discovered that, with the competition all unfolding over the course of a single day, the webcast wasn\u2019t happening. So coffees were transferred into travel mugs and we got ourselves down to the beach for some good old-fashioned spectating.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">In years past, the longboard contest has been a part of the three-day Rip Curl Nationals, but this year all the action played out in a one-day, standalone event.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cYou can blame the ISA,\u201d says the Canadian Surf Association\u2019s Dom Domic. \u201cThere was an announcement, maybe in December, that ISA World Longboard was happening in April and we&#8217;d already committed to Nationals in May. So in order to do team selections, we decided that instead of moving the whole Nationals into March, the best way to do it was to splinter it off and have a longboard only event.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The one-day event ran without a hitch and the sunshine brought out a sizeable crowd.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cI was shocked how many people were down there on the beach supporting the surfers,\u201d says Domic. \u201cIt was almost as packed as our usual Nationals.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The crowd was treated to high-quality longboard action all day long. The women all surfed with poise and style, but nobody could keep up with an in-form Mathea Olin, even though the day was a departure from her usual board of choice.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cI shortboard 99% of the time and I can\u2019t even remember the last time I longboarded, so I had fun today hopping on one,\u201d she says.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Her win marked her third consecutive Nationals longboard victory.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cI don\u2019t really keep track but it\u2019s always trying to push myself on a longer board.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">And the men put on a good show as well, with highlight reel moments from each heat. But the action culminated in the final between Adam Tory, Jean Laurens Vachon Vigneault, David Schiaffino and Rusty Goyer. With five minutes left, Goyer cross-stepped from fourth place to first, hanging all ten toes over the nose and styling his way to victory.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cWave of the day\u201d said Asia Dryden, who was watching from the beach after being knocked out in the semis. \u201cThat was amazing. I\u2019m really happy to see someone win with a really solid hang ten.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cYeah it\u2019s pretty crazy I did not expect that but I\u2019m super super stoked,\u201d says Goyer of his win. Now he and Schiaffino are the two men set to represent Canada in El Salvador at the ISA Worlds from April 19th\u2013 25th. As for the women, Liv Stokes\u2014who qualified through the World Surf League\u2014will be there representing Canada. And Mathea\u2019s working on a personal project, so she may give her spot to Carolyn Day, who got second at the Rip Curl Nationals.
